Description

Prebends Cottage is a cottage dating to circa 1771. It is constructed of sandstone rubble with a pantile roof, featuring a single row of stone slates along the eaves. A brick chimney is also present. The cottage is one storey and consists of three bays. A six-panelled double door, set one step up and protected by a stone lintel, provides access to the front. Windows have stone lintels and projecting sills, and feature 16-paned sashes with external shutters. Large blocks define the gable edges. The left return gable, located on the path towards Prebends' Bridge, incorporates a cellar door and an oriel window. This building holds group value from its contribution to the Prebends area.
